Joseph GAREAU dit ST-ONGE was born 30 November 1785 in Beloeil, Province of Québec, Canada
Joseph GAREAU dit ST-ONGE was the child of Joseph GAREAU dit ST-ONGE and Marie-Louise BROUILLET and the grandchild of: (paternal) Joseph GAREAU dit ST ONGE and Marie-Josephte MORVAN (MORVENT) (maternal) Pierre BROUILLET and Marguerite LEFORTS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Joseph married Marie-Louise MENARD 15 August 1808 in Chambly, Lower Canada .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Marie-Louise MENARD was born 28 August 1788 in Chambly, Québec, Canada (Saint-Joseph-de-Chambly). Marie-Louise was the child of Joseph MENARD and Marie-Amable DARAGON dite LAFRANCE.
